Area contextNeighborhood Overview – C. Wesley Armstrong Memorial Park (Trenton, NJ)
C. Wesley Armstrong Memorial Park is situated in the eastern section of Trenton, New Jersey, offering a accessible location for residents and visiting teams. The park is bordered by Ewingville Road to the north and easily accessible via Route 1 and I-295, major arteries that connect Trenton to Philadelphia and New York City. Parking is available directly within the park grounds, with specific areas designated for team load-in and general spectator use. For those arriving from further afield, Philadelphia International Airport (PHL) is approximately a 45-minute to an hour drive, depending on traffic, while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) is about an hour to an hour and fifteen minutes away. Public transportation options are limited directly to the park, with bus routes serving the general Ewingville Road vicinity but requiring a walk to the park entrance. Smart arrival tactics suggest allowing ample time for parking, especially on tournament days, and coordinating team drop-offs to avoid congestion.

Grounds For Sculpture
A remarkable outdoor sculpture park, Grounds For Sculpture offers a unique and visually stimulating experience. Spread across 42 acres of meticulously landscaped gardens, it features over 300 works of art by renowned artists. It's an ideal destination for a change of pace, providing a relaxed environment for families and teams to explore art and nature. The park’s indoor restaurant, Rat’s, also offers a distinctive dining experience. This is a fantastic option for a post-game outing or a diversion on a rainy day.
Hamilton Ave · 4.5 miTrenton Thunder Baseball - Trenton Thunder Ballpark
While not always active depending on the season, the Trenton Thunder Ballpark is a central sports landmark in the city. Home to the former Double-A Eastern League affiliate of the New York Yankees, it now hosts collegiate summer baseball and other events. If a game or event is scheduled during your visit, it offers a classic minor league baseball atmosphere. Even when empty, the ballpark represents a significant part of Trenton’s sports heritage and is worth noting for baseball enthusiasts.

Weather & Seasons at C. Wesley Armstrong Memorial Park
- Winter: Winter in Trenton brings cold temperatures, often with highs in the 30s and 40s Fahrenheit. Outdoor activities at the park are minimal. Visitors should pack heavy winter coats, hats, gloves, and waterproof footwear if traveling through the area. Driving can be impacted by snow or ice, so checking local road conditions is essential.
- Spring & early summer: Spring sees temperatures warming into the 50s and 60s, gradually increasing into the 70s and 80s by early summer. This period is prime time for park activities. Light jackets or sweaters are useful for cooler mornings and evenings, while t-shirts and shorts are standard for daytime games. Be prepared for occasional spring showers, which can cause temporary field closures.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er brings consistent heat and humidity, with daytime temperatures frequently reaching the high 80s and 90s Fahrenheit. Hydration is paramount for players and spectators. Lightweight, breathable clothing is a must. Sunscreen, hats, and portable shade structures are highly recommended to manage the strong sun and heat during games.
- Fall season: Fall offers crisp air and comfortable temperatures, typically ranging from the 50s to 70s Fahrenheit. This is another excellent season for sports. Layers are key, with visitors packing long-sleeved shirts, light sweaters, and perhaps a light jacket for cooler mornings and evenings. The park remains active with late-season tournaments and league play.
- Rain & snow: Rain can occur year-round, potentially leading to game cancellations or delays, especially during spring and fall. Snow is primarily a winter phenomenon and can create hazardous driving conditions and temporarily close park facilities. Always check the park's status and local weather forecasts before heading out, particularly if conditions are inclement.
